Useful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) for Small Businesses - Avinash Kaushik (9:47)

Dr. Ralph F. Wilson Web Marketing Today - May 19, 2009

In this video interview, Analytics expert Avinash Kaushik outlines various types of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) for small businesses -- especially looking at where people come from, what content is being consumed, and measuring outcomes.

Ask, says Avinash: (1) Where do people come from, looking at percent of visits across all traffic sources, with bounce rate. Ask: (2) What content is being consumed, looking at the top ten entry pages, most viewed pages, and product pages. Finally, (3) measure outcomes that are important to your business. Outcomes are variations on (a) increased revenue, (b) reduced cost, or (c) increased customer satisfaction and retention. Article content sites will learn from looking at visitor loyalty and visitor recency.



Avinash Kaushik is a co-founder of MarketMotive, Analytics Evangelist for Google.com, and writes a blog Occam's Razor. This interview was recorded on May 6, 2009 at the Emetrics Marketing Optmization Summit in San Jose, CA.
